Job Description
Summary:
Geography Teacher required for August 2026 at a top-rated school.
About the School:
A school with over 30 years of experience in delivering a British curriculum from Foundation Stage to Year 13. It is committed to fostering a vibrant, inclusive community and promoting academic excellence with a strong focus on student wellbeing.
The Opportunity:
A Geography Teacher is needed to join a dynamic and forward-thinking school in August 2026. This role offers the opportunity to inspire students, contribute to a thriving academic environment, and be part of a highly respected institution with an Outstanding BSO rating.
Key Responsibilities:
- Deliver high-quality Geography lessons to students from Key Stage 3 through to A Level.
- Develop innovative and engaging teaching strategies that reflect the school’s commitment to academic excellence.
- Support the pastoral care and wellbeing of students, ensuring a safe and inclusive learning environment.
- Contribute to the wider curriculum by teaching other science subjects to Key Stage 3 and/or Key Stage 4 where required.
- Collaborate with colleagues to enhance the learning experience and promote a culture of continuous improvement.
- Participate in professional development and training opportunities to ensure the highest standards of teaching.
- Play an active role in the safeguarding and welfare of students.
- Engage in extracurricular activities and contribute to the school’s vibrant community life.
Qualifications & Skills:
Required
- A good honours degree.
- A QTS or PGCE teaching qualification, preferably from the UK.
- Minimum of two years’ experience in teaching.
- Ability to provide an ICPC and a UK enhanced DBS or equivalent police check.
- Professional appearance and conduct.
- Commitment to the school’s vision, values, and purpose.
Preferred
- Experience teaching Geography through to A Level.
- Experience in teaching other science subjects to Key Stage 3 and/or Key Stage 4.
- Strong interpersonal and communication skills.
- A proactive approach to pastoral care and student wellbeing.
- Demonstrated ability to support the academic and personal development of students.
Compensation & Benefits:
- Tax-free salary based on experience.
- Housing allowance to support relocation.
- Comprehensive medical insurance coverage.
- Annual flight allowance for returning home.
